What "licensed" truly implies in Texas
The word accredited is not home window clothing. In Texas, electrical experts must hold energetic qualifications with the Texas Department of Licensing and Policy. That structure includes Pupil, Residential Electrician, Journeyman, and Master Electrician degrees. Each step requires documented hours in the field, class education and learning, and passing state examinations. A licensed electrician in The Nest functions under that framework, lugs called for insurance coverage, and understands the National Electrical Code together with local changes that the city enforces.
Electricians also function within an allowing system. The City of The Swarm problems licenses and timetables evaluations for many work beyond straightforward fixture replacements. When a job requires utility coordination with Oncor, or a load computation to verify your service can sustain an EV battery charger, an accredited contractor understands the series: permit, rough-in inspection, final, and utility release if the meter requires to be pulled. Reducing corners is not only risky, it usually sets you back more once the assessor captures it or your home increases available for sale and an appraiser flags unpermitted work.

How unlicensed work drains pipes budgets
I have been contacted us to homes where a single poor receptacle became 3 days of detective job. Someone had replaced a kitchen area GFCI without recognizing the lots and line terminals. An additional had sissy chained half a dining room from a microwave circuit. A handyman added recessed containers in a bedroom, then connected them into a smoke alarm feed. All of it seemed to work for a while. Then a storm rolled with, lights lowered, and a breaker declined to reset.
Each of those check outs required troubleshooting that might have been prevented with standard code knowledge. Accredited electrical contractors recognize which rooms require arc fault security, which require ground mistake, just how to divide little device circuits in kitchen areas, and how to size conductors and overcurrent defense. They make use of correct junction boxes, not buried splices. They maintain neutrals separated in subpanels. These are not scholastic details. They are the distinction between a 90 min repair and a 2 see challenge that ends with drywall repairs.

Case notes from around town
A home owner near the lake mounted a portable medspa. The supplier stated to plug it right into a basic outlet. It worked up until a stormy week. The GFCI stumbled. The proprietor reset it a number of times, then called. The circuit offering that electrical outlet also fed outside lights and a garage fridge freezer. The load was limited on completely dry days and over the side in wet weather. We mounted a dedicated GFCI-protected circuit in PVC channel with a proper detach, fixed the fridge freezer electrical outlet to a different circuit as needed for garage receptacles, and secured the health facility's cord link factor from dash. The health facility ran dependably, the fridge freezer quit thawing, and the lights stopped lowering. Three issues taken care of in an early morning due to the fact that the underlying design was fixed rather than band-aided.
At a little retail room off Main, the renter experienced flickering lights and POS system restarts. The panel was full, with numerous tandem breakers and a couple of neutrals increased under one lug. The quick response would have been to swap a flickering ballast and call it excellent. We rather determined voltage decline under load and discovered a weak neutral link from a shared multiwire branch circuit. Securing the neutral, moving circuits to get rid of common neutrals without a two-pole breaker, and replacing aging ballasts solved the flicker and the reboots. The register stopped losing transactions, which is a much faster way to save cash than chasing after low-cost parts.
Modern loads and smart homes transform the math
More homes in The Swarm currently have EVs. Many have 2. A 40 to 50 amp EV battery charger is not unusual, and dual battery chargers can overwhelm a 150 amp solution when stoves and a/c fused. Some homes also add induction cooktops, which pull significant amperage at high setups. A qualified electrician evaluates existing loads, runs an estimation, and provides options. That could be a solution upgrade, a lots monitoring tool that startles charging, or a specialized subpanel with area for future circuits so you do not paint the same edge in a year.
Smart switches and whole-home automation bring their own wrinkles. Some older homes lack neutral cords in button boxes, which several clever tools require. Selecting gadgets that deal with two-wire setups or planning neutral runs stops returns and disappointment. Rise security at the panel is an additional smart relocate a storm-prone area. A moderate investment there conserves delicate electronics and heads off nuisance lockups that you will certainly or else criticize on your Wi-Fi.
Preventive upkeep that really pays off
Electrical systems do not require consistent tinkering, yet routine checks are cheap insurance policy. I recommend a panel inspection every few years, specifically prior to summer. Search for staining on breakers, aluminum feeders that need antioxidant compound, signs of moisture at service entrances, and correct labeling that a future emergency situation will make you appreciate. Test GFCI and AFCI devices twice a year. Replace receptacles with loosened plugs or warmth staining around the ports. If your home has had roofing system or pipes leaks, think about an infrared check to capture covert wetness near electrical boxes prior to deterioration collections in.
Businesses ought to budget for a yearly panel and link check, specifically where equipment runs throughout the day. Thermal imaging during operating hours identifies warm connections prior to they stop working. Tightening lugs to supplier torque specs and changing aging breakers beats a mid-day shutdown with customers in the store.

How do electricians check wiring?
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.
